The Power of Freeze Frame

Freeze frame, or frame grabbing, is a technique that involves extracting a single frame from a moving image sequence. This can be done using software or hardware tools, and the resulting image can be used as a still photograph, a graphic element, or even as a starting point for further manipulation and experimentation. The power of freeze frame lies in its ability to capture a moment in time, to freeze the action and emotion of a scene, and to create a new narrative or interpretation that is unique to the viewer.

Applications in Art and Design

Frame grabbing has a wide range of applications in art and design, from fine art photography to graphic design, illustration, and even filmmaking. By capturing a single frame from a video or film sequence, artists and designers can create:

  • Stunning still images: Frame grabbing can be used to extract a single frame from a video sequence, creating a still image that is both beautiful and evocative.
  • Graphic elements: Frame grabbed images can be used as graphic elements in design projects, adding texture, depth, and emotion to a composition.
  • Illustrations: Frame grabbing can be used to create illustrations that are both detailed and dynamic, capturing the movement and energy of a scene.
  • Experimental art: Frame grabbing can be used to create experimental art pieces that challenge our perceptions of time and space, using techniques such as time-lapse, slow-motion, and stop-motion.
